In-flight meal is a meal served to passengers. Using an airline service trolley, passengers are typically served these meals, which are prepared by specialized airline catering services. The safety and hygienic conditions of in-flight dining establishments are crucial. Food analysis laboratories can be located on the premises of flight kitchens to carry out various tests necessary for adherence to food standards.

The airline catering industry has long acknowledged the critical nature of food safety, as evidenced by its continued dedication to the creation of industry standards. It has been acknowledged that a food safety management system covering every aspect of food production, from product design to on-board service, is necessary to guarantee the safety of food and drink when consumed on-board. The World Food Safety Guidelines for Airline Catering serve as a fundamental point of reference for all parties involved and outline an efficient food safety control concept that is applicable to the airline industry globally. Some food and catering services that do not comply with food safety regulations and guidelines for in-flight catering services may be eliminated due to the strict regulations.

The term “in-flight catering services market” refers to the provision of food, beverages, and other related services to airlines for their passengers while on flights. To enhance the overall traveller experience and set airlines apart in a crowded market, in-flight catering services must be improved. As airlines work to improve their onboard facilities, the market for in-flight catering services is predicted to grow steadily, offering opportunities for food service providers and suppliers to adapt to changing passenger preferences.

The growth of the in-flight catering services market in the Middle East and Africa is driven by various factors. Economic and demographic growth contribute to the increasing number of airline passengers and flights, with the growing middle class stimulating airline activity. The emergence of low-cost airlines offering competitive prices on popular routes also plays a role. Airports with strong commercial orientations and those serving as major hubs attract additional demand for air travel. Moreover, rising disposable income leads to increased consumer spending, creating demand for high-quality and customized meals during flights. The trend towards convenience food, driven by busy lifestyles and a shift in consumer preferences, further fuels the growth of in-flight catering services, with a focus on health consciousness and urban lifestyles.

The Middle East and Africa In-Flight Catering Services market is confronted with difficulties. Due to the limited storage space available in aircraft, effective inventory management and coordination between airlines and catering services are required. To fulfil demand and guarantee prompt service, it is essential to optimise the storage and delivery procedures.

Impact of COVID-19 on Middle East and Africa In-Flight Catering Services Market 

The Middle East and Africa’s in-flight catering services business has been significantly impacted by the COVID-19 outbreak. There has been a significant drop in demand for in-flight catering services as a result of the pervasive travel restrictions, reduced flight operations, and loss in passenger numbers. Many food establishments had to temporarily close due to airport closures and airline delays, placing financial hardship on the sector. Additionally, the cost of running for catering businesses has grown because to the strict health and safety rules put in place to stop the virus’ spread. The market is also facing additional difficulties due to the unpredictability of travel and shifting consumer preferences for safer food options.
